Ionic is a platform that facilitates creating mobile apps with web technologies by web programmers. The Ionic template allows developers to create mobile apps on different platforms that can be installed on Windows, Android, and iOS phones. The Ionic framework uses other frameworks such as Phonegap, ASS, and Angular JS to develop hybrid mobile applications.

Key Features

Ionic facilitates building hybrid apps using HTML5 due to its open-source framework and also it’s completely free. The use of Angular JS makes it perfect for developing highly interactive apps and it has a great range of tools and services that make running Ionic fairly easy.
Ionic comes with CLI which helps mobile developers build and test Ionic apps on any platform. It allows users to scroll through thousands of lists without any performance hits. Users are able to create their own apps, customize them for Windows , Android, iOS and deploy through Cordova.

Advantages of Ionic Framework
1. Cross-Platform Usability

The Iconic is compatible on several platforms and can be optimized for various mobile operating systems. Developing code is significantly easier and faster since Ionic is easily integrated into Angular JS to set up code structure. This leads to developing new concepts faster and on lower budgets.

2. Friendly User Interface

The Ionic framework incorporates key concepts such as Java Scripts and CSS components to optimize facilitate easy to use interfaces in any mobile application. Components such as navigation tabs, sliding menu, buttons, lists, form inputs, pop-ups and prompts are very simple and sleek and easily customized for a particular mobile app.
The Ionic framework, therefore, creates beautiful and interactive user interfaces in a remarkably short period of time.

3. Free and Open Source Framework

Since Ionic is open source, developers can customize different looks and feels on various mobile operating systems without incurring large costs. Ionic gives codes of CSS, JS and HTML components which reduce the need to rewrite code for a new mobile operating system. Ionic’s easy integration with Angular JS facilitates easier and better code structure creation.
Developing apps on Windows, Android and iOS is thus faster and easy to do. Building apps move quickly from development to the market and this boosts marketing and creates awareness and popularity of apps. Ionic helps to save money, time and efforts.

4. Feasible and Easy Development of Cross Mobile Apps

Developing an app quickly is critical in today’s mobile app conscious generation. The other concept is that app development needs to be compatible across all mobile devices. Ionic has excelled in developing apps efficiently, using standard tools with a single coding base which saves money, time and effort and provides an integrated look and feel.

5. Based on Angular

The Ionic framework is based on Angular JS compatibility which then broadens the ease and functionality of the Angular framework to make creating mobile apps easy as pie. As of today, Angular JS marks the most favorite JavaScript framework currently in use and is backed by Google.